Ponce City Market in May will welcome a new pop-up shop from The LB Brand.

The 750-square-foot store adjacent Ponce Denim Company will carry The LB Brand’s full line of apparel for women, men, and children, along with accessories and home decor.

Customers will have the option to check out via an iPad and have their purchases delivered with same-day shipping.

The shop will house a designated Selfie Spot as well as an interactive “Polaroid Bar” that gives customers the option to take photos during their visit.

Photos uploaded with the hashtag #myLBpolaroid could be featured on the brand’s Instagram account.

The LB brand made its debut in 2013 as a children’s apparel brand but “after feeling dissatisfied with the standard pattern and design selection for infant and toddler clothing, LB founder Jen Roberts created unique blueprints, slogans, and illustrations for her son that spoke to childhood in a non-uniform way.”

She originally named the brand “Little Boogaweezin,” which was her son’s nickname.

It later became The LB Brand.
